How does eyebrow transplantation work?
Eyebrow transplantation is a minimally invasive surgical procedure that involves transplanting hair follicles from a donor area, typically the back of the scalp, to the eyebrow region. The process begins with the extraction of individual hair follicles using either the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) or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) method. These follicles are then carefully implanted into tiny incisions made along the eyebrow area, following the natural growth pattern and desired shape.
What are the advantages of eyebrow transplantation over microblading?
While microblading has gained popularity as a semi-permanent solution for enhancing eyebrows, eyebrow transplantation offers several distinct advantages. Unlike microblading, which creates the illusion of hair through pigment, transplantation uses real hair follicles, resulting in a truly natural appearance. The transplanted hair grows and behaves like natural eyebrow hair, allowing for trimming and grooming. Additionally, eyebrow transplants provide a permanent solution, eliminating the need for frequent touch-ups required with microblading.
Can you get same-day results with eyebrow transplants in Minnesota?
While the actual transplant procedure can be completed in a single day, it’s important to note that the full results of eyebrow transplantation are not immediate. The transplanted hair follicles typically shed within the first few weeks after the procedure, which is a normal part of the process. New hair growth begins around 3-4 months post-procedure, with final results becoming visible after 6-12 months. However, patients in Minnesota can expect to see an improvement in their eyebrow appearance immediately after the procedure, as the transplanted follicles create a fuller look.
What is the recovery process like for eyebrow transplantation?
The recovery process for eyebrow transplantation is relatively quick and straightforward. Most patients can return to their normal activities within a few days of the procedure. Some minor swelling and redness around the eyebrow area are common but typically subside within a week. It’s crucial to follow post-operative care instructions provided by your surgeon, which may include avoiding strenuous activities, protecting the transplanted area from direct sunlight, and using prescribed medications to promote healing and prevent infection.
Are there any risks or side effects associated with eyebrow transplants?
As with any surgical procedure, eyebrow transplantation carries some risks, though they are generally minimal. Potential side effects may include temporary numbness, itching, or slight bruising in the treated area. In rare cases, patients may experience infection or poor graft survival. However, choosing a qualified and experienced surgeon in Minnesota can significantly reduce these risks. It’s essential to discuss potential complications and your medical history with your doctor during the consultation phase to ensure you’re a suitable candidate for the procedure.
